Sunday's Women's Tri at Winding Trails

Originally they posted that wave 1 - would be 35-44 - makes sense - 2 a/gs - very fast, winner will likely come from here. Fast ladies get to race on a course with no one ahead of them.

Today they send out new race details. Wave 1 is now 35-41. Yes, 41, you read it correctly. The rest of the 40-44 a/g gets to wait 6 mins and start 2 waves later and then fight their way past ALL competitors 41 yrs and younger.

Is it just me, or is this just not right? (BTW, I am of course in the higher end of the 40-44 a/g). I know that a tri is basically an individual time trial but it would be nice to be able to literally race against the people I am competing against rather than wonder what they are doing 2 waves ahead of me.

Interested in what peeps think. Any other races do anything wierd like this?
